Smart Toys

Smart toys combine physical play with digital or electronic elements to support learning, creativity and engagement for children. Educational smart toys and interactive smart toys often incorporate lights, sounds, sensors or connectivity to encourage exploration and problem-solving. Educational toys for kids and learning toys for children may focus on early literacy, numeracy, coding or logic skills.

Kids smart learning devices can include tablets designed specifically for children, programmable robots or interactive books that respond to touch. Bilingual learning toys and STEM learning toys introduce languages and science, technology, engineering and maths concepts in age-appropriate ways. Electronic educational toys and toys for child development are usually designed with developmental stages in mind, while smart toys for toddlers tend to focus on simple cause-and-effect interactions and sensory experiences.

Benefits of smart learning toys

  • Engaging educational content:Educational smart toys and learning toys for children often present concepts through play, using repetition, stories and challenges to help children absorb information more naturally than through formal instruction alone.
  • Adaptive and interactive features:Interactive smart toys and kids smart learning devices typically respond to children’s actions with feedback, encouraging experimentation and sustained attention, while some toys adjust difficulty as skills grow.
  • Support for multiple skills:Bilingual learning toys and STEM learning toys can help with language development, problem-solving and basic coding or engineering thinking, supporting broader educational goals through fun activities.
  • Age-appropriate design:Smart toys for toddlers and toys for child development are usually built with safety, durability and cognitive stages in mind, offering simple controls, robust materials and content suited to specific age groups.

Choosing and using smart toys

When choosing smart toys, carers may want to look at recommended age ranges, educational focus and content sources, ensuring that educational smart toys and electronic educational toys align with learning goals and values. For kids smart learning devices that connect online, parental controls and content filters can be important for managing access. Bilingual learning toys and STEM learning toys should be matched to children’s current levels so that challenges remain engaging but not overwhelming. Regularly updating or charging interactive smart toys and reviewing progress features can help carers understand how children are using these products.

Frequently Asked Questions

What age are smart toys for toddlers generally suitable for?

Smart toys for toddlers are typically designed for children around one to three years old, though specific age recommendations vary; checking manufacturer guidance helps ensure toys match developmental stages.

How do educational smart toys differ from standard toys?

Educational smart toys are usually created with explicit learning objectives in mind, incorporating content and interactions that reinforce skills such as numbers, letters or logic, whereas standard toys may focus more on free play without structured educational elements.

Are kids smart learning devices safe for unsupervised use?

Many kids smart learning devices include parental controls and content filters, but supervision is often recommended, particularly for younger children, to ensure appropriate use and to support learning.

What makes STEM learning toys effective?

STEM learning toys are effective when they encourage hands-on experimentation, open-ended problem-solving and curiosity about how things work, rather than simply delivering fixed outcomes.

How can carers assess the quality of interactive smart toys?

Carers can assess quality by reviewing content, build durability, safety certifications, user reviews and how well the toy holds children’s attention without relying solely on overstimulating lights or sounds.
